What is the penalty for a first offense of speeding?

Explanation:
The penalty for a first offense of speeding for junior operators in Massachusetts involves a 90-day suspension of driving privileges and the requirement to retake the learner's permit exam. This regulation is in place to emphasize the importance of safe driving practices and to discourage reckless behavior among young and inexperienced drivers. By making violators retake the learner's permit exam, the state ensures that they are reminded of the rules of the road and the serious consequences associated with speeding. The 90-day suspension also serves as a significant consequence, encouraging junior operators to be more cautious and responsible while driving.
